>Can anybody please tell me how to install Majorcool on my website?
>
>
>
I presume you have majordomo running.  

Unpack the files into an appropriate place on your web site, probably a
directory within cgi-bin and then telnet into the site and type sh
Configure and follow the instructions.

Oh forgot one bit, ensure you have a good supply of alcohol, food and a
weekend to spare.

When you get to creating and configuring the default.sh you WILL have
more questions.  I actually found it easier to edit default.sh directly
so that information inputted was saved and I could mess around with each
entry until 4 weeks later I got it right.  In this case the instruction
line is sh Configure default.sh or you can of course call it anything
you like.sh
